Education and Experience Requirements
High School Diploma or GED required. 2 years related structural assembly experience. Experience working with Solumina and Smarteam preferred..

Position Purpose:
In a team-oriented work environment, under minimal supervision, performs a variety of structural assembly operations in a production department.

Job Description
Principle Duties and Responsibilities:
Essential Functions:
Perform assembly and fitting of detail parts and structures and varied drilling and riveting operations; ensures parts/assembly meet requirements.
Rivet structural assemblies and parts using all tools required. to do the job (e.g. portable riveting guns, pneumatic guns, pneumatic drills, counter sinks, rivet shavers, files, reamers, rivets). Must display the ability to remove fasteners without damaging structure.
Read work orders, blueprints, lofts, sketches and operation sheets to determine sequence of operations, type size and hole pattern for rivets.
Check all work and ensure a defective free assembly prior to final inspection.
Maintain and use all logs and records (e.g. MIR sheets, DMTs, Crabs, PCOs).
Align and assemble parts to be riveted using jigs, holding fixtures, pins, clamps, and fasteners.
Make repairs per Discrepant Material Tags (DMT), Material Review Request (MRR), Production Change Orders (PCO), performs necessary rework to ensure installations meet conformity. .
Maintain a neat and orderly work area, supports the company 5S Program, and complies with all safety regulations.
Able to work with minimal supervision on duties and tasks.
Support Lean Activities.
Perform other duties as assigned.

Other Requirements:
Must be able to read and interpret blue prints.
Must be skilled in close tolerance work and have knowledge of use of special tools and equipment.
Must be able to use mathematical formulas by solving dimensional problems using fractions, decimal fractions and whole numbers.
Basic computer skills.
Must be able to read a scale and perform basic shop math.
Read and comprehend basic documents and instructions.
Must have essential personal skills, which include an aptitude for hands-on craftwork, a professional attitude, attention to detail, ability to work with people and to meet demanding schedules.
Must demonstrate good housekeeping and safety practices.
Ability to work with composite resins and materials.
Must be able to lift 50 lbs.
Must be able to work any shift.
Must be able to climb ladders/stands/stairs and work in small spaces and/or restricted areas.
